I find it sad that apparently reputable auctioneers stoop to creating some fictitious identity for some of their cars. The Wentworth Special, as they call it, is just an 1980s backyard special built on a destroyed 1926 Wentworth saloon. Giving it the prefix the implies some sort of historical significance which just doesn't exist; and whilst I'm in angry mode, why do they spend half the description extolling the virtues of the twin-cam Nine which has nothing to do with this car, other than being its replacement? |
